On Tue, Oct 26, 2010 at 8:46 PM, Josh Kupershmidt <schmiddy@gmail.com> wrote:
> It looks like effective_io_concurrency only has an impact on bitmap
> heap scans. I think a brief mention of this fact in the docs for
> effective_io_concurrency should suffice, patch attached.

Good idea, committed.
